The domestic cement industry has again, in July, shown a double-digit despatch growth, fifth month in a row since March. The 227-million tonne industry grew at 10.56 per cent in July, which in the corresponding month last year stood at 8.13 per cent.
The industry, with over 50 players, despatched 16.02 million tonnes of the building material in the month. The production grew to 16.28 mt, up 11.2 per cent, as per provisional data from the Cement Manufacturers’ Association (CMA).
Though the sector managed to sustain a double-digit growth in July, the month so far has registered the lowest growth in the current financial year. On a sequential basis, the growth dipped by over 2 per cent.
Hari Mohan Bangur, president of CMA, said, “Demand has remained strong during the month and the growth came because of the low base effect. We hope this kind of growth will continue till September.”
According to analysts, the industry has performed well despite region-specific rain during the month. A section of analysts had forecast a growth of 9 per cent in July.
According to cement players, the growth will taper from October onwards, as in the third quarter of FY09. They maintain that the current financial year will end with a 9 per cent growth, against a below 8 per cent growth registered last year.
